What is FakeYou Really?
FakeYou positions itself as the go-to platform for AI voice cloning and text-to-speech conversion. The tool claims to offer over 3,000 voices including celebrities, fictional characters, and regular people. You type text, pick a voice, and theoretically get realistic speech output.
The reality? It’s more complicated than their marketing suggests.
I’ve spent weeks testing FakeYou across different use cases. Some voices sound convincing. Others make you question if the AI had a stroke. The platform’s biggest draw – celebrity voices – comes with legal gray areas that could land you in hot water.
FakeYou Features Breakdown
Text-to-Speech Generation
The core feature converts your text into speech using AI voices. The process is simple:
- Type your text
- Choose from the voice library
- Click “Speak”
- Wait in queue (more on this nightmare later)
Reality Check: Voice quality varies wildly. Popular characters like Donald Trump or cartoon voices often sound decent. Lesser-known voices? Robotic garbage that screams “AI generated.”
Voice-to-Voice Conversion
Upload your recording and transform it into another voice. Sounds cool in theory.
The Truth: This feature works best with clear, studio-quality recordings. Background noise, accents, or poor audio quality result in unintelligible output. You’re better off re-recording with proper equipment.
Voice Cloning
Create custom AI voices from audio samples. FakeYou’s voice cloning requires multiple samples and patience.

Video Lip Sync
Synchronize generated audio with video content.
The Problem: Limited to short clips and requires premium subscriptions for reasonable video lengths. The synchronization often looks unnatural.
FakeYou Pricing Analysis
Plan | Price | Features | Our Rating |
---|---|---|---|
Free | $0 | 12-second clips, long wait times, ads | ❌ Barely usable |
Plus | $7/month | 30-second TTS, 4-min voice conversion | ⚠️ Limited value |
Pro | $15/month | 1-min TTS, 5-min voice conversion, private models | ✅ Decent for casual use |
Elite | $25/month | 2-min TTS, unlimited voice conversion, commercial voices | ⚠️ Overpriced for features |

The Queue Problem Nobody Talks About
Here’s what FakeYou doesn’t advertise: the wait times are brutal.
Free users often wait 5-15 minutes during peak hours. Even paid users experience delays. I’ve had 30-second clips take over 10 minutes to process during busy periods.
Why This Matters: If you’re creating content on deadlines, these delays kill productivity. Professional voice AI services maintain consistent processing speeds regardless of demand.

Legal and Ethical Concerns
Celebrity Voice Rights
Using celebrity voices for commercial content without permission could violate publicity rights. FakeYou provides these voices but doesn’t handle legal compliance.
Business Risk: Companies using celebrity voices in marketing content face potential lawsuits. Always consult legal counsel before using celebrity voices commercially.
Content Authenticity
AI-generated voices raise questions about content authenticity. Some platforms require disclosure when using AI voices.
Best Practice: Always disclose AI-generated content to maintain audience trust and comply with platform policies.
